A rigorous technical breakdown of the four main wavelengths used in modern aesthetic laser methods.
| Wavelength | Primary Target Chromophore | Optimal Fitzpatrick Skin Type | Absorption Characteristics | Clinical Advantages |
|---|---|---|---|---|
| 755nm (Alexandrite) | Melanin (High Absorption) | Skin Types I - III | Strongest absorption coefficient in melanin, shallow penetration. | Highly effective for fine, lightly pigmented hairs; rapid execution. |
| 808nm / 810nm (Diode) | Melanin (Moderate) & Follicle Bulb | Skin Types I - VI | Optimal balance between melanin absorption and deep tissue penetration. | Gold standard for universal hair removal; high safety profile. |
| 940nm (Infrared Diode) | Micro-vessels (Oxyhemoglobin) | Skin Types II - VI | Targets the vascular supply feeding the hair follicle bulb. | Prevents regrowth by cutting off nutrient supply to active roots. |
| 1064nm (Long-pulse Nd:YAG) | Water & Deep Vasculature | Skin Types V - VI (Dark/Tanned) | Lowest melanin absorption; deepest dermal penetration bypasses epidermis. | Safest profile for dark-toned skin; avoids hyperpigmentation risks. |

The convergence of Artificial Intelligence with dynamic cooling and high-density diode technology (2025–2030).
The integration of digital technology into aesthetic devices is revolutionizing laser hair removal methods. Future software stacks will feature real-time skin tone analysis using high-resolution digital optical sensors on the applicator head. Instead of manually selecting Fitzpatrick levels, the system automatically adjusts fluence, pulse width, and cooling parameters based on the live melanin index of the skin. This minimizes human error, improves safety protocols, and enhances overall clinical outcomes.
